Abstract

Analysis of existing drought management policies in some countries, including Iran, indicates that decision-makers mainly react to drought episodes through a crisis-management approach, instead of developing a comprehensive and long-term policies. One of the comprehensive programs is the drought risk management model adopted in the member state of the European Union (EU), which is based on the EU Water Framework Directive (WFD). In the present study, the above-mentioned document along with the experiences of different countries faced with the drought crisis was analyzed in order to prepare a drought management plan for the country. This study is an applied research performed through library studies based on scientific and international resources. The results showed that in the process of drought management, creation of organizational capacity is the main factor to evaluate drought and its various effects on the community. This can only be achieved through the establishment of a Drought Independent Committee. On the other hand, drought management should be seen as a risk management process that emphasizes permanent monitoring of resources and observes climate change in the monitored area, rather than the onest of disaster as a crisis management. Drought management has been accepted by the international community in terms of risk management instead of crisis management. The proposed plan presented in this study is based on active drought management (risk management) that provides appropriate plans and preparedness for drought response, by offering long-term planning and forecasting.
